Transaction 71867f95d9eb903833d43bf8f45ecef6da95aac9a4b453300284f348bcc4c166
1 Input
1 Output
-
71867f95d9eb903833d43bf8f45ecef6da95aac9a4b453300284f348bcc4c166:0
- value
- 41718799
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5441325d5ae84778eeb3b055c4a8a1ce21a3938c OP_EQUAL
- address
- MFaf6VXWVDJwem663td1FWk2x29NJBpPuU